WebbHydrolysis is a chemical reaction or process in which a molecule is split into two parts by reacting with a molecule of water, which has the chemical formula H 2 O. Zhuozhi … Webb1.1.1 Acid hydrolysis Acid hydrolysis is the most common method for hydrolyzing a protein sample, and the method can be performed in either vapor or liquid phase. Although a range of different acids can be used for this reaction, the most common is 6 M HCl.

Two glucose molecules can be linked together through a dehydration synthesis reaction to form a disaccharide called maltose.
